A Water Damage Restoration loss touches several distinct phases, and our Garner, IA crews are built to carry each one without losing continuity.

The first call triggers immediate standing-water extraction using truck-mount pumps, before moisture spreads further into the structure.
Moisture meters and thermal imaging identify exactly which materials are still wet once the visible water is gone.
We track drying progress with daily moisture logs so the numbers, not a guess, tell us when a space is ready.
Our project lead lines up reconstruction trades directly off the mitigation scope, so Garner, IA homeowners aren't left waiting between phases.
Content pack-out and cleaning is coordinated alongside the structural work so nothing sits in a damaged room longer than necessary.
